How Can I Reset the Multisim or Ultiboard User Interface to its Default Configuration?Hardware: PXI/CompactPCI>>Controllers
Problem: I was using the Options » Customize User Interface... dialog to add commands to my menus. I accidentally deleted one of my menus entirely. Now I can't get that menu back to my user interface. In other cases, I am missing menu items or I locked my Multisim User Interface as a Simplified Version. Solution: Multisim and Ultiboard allows you to customize your user interface experience. You can add/delete functions from menus and buttons from the toolbars. You can also modify the menu hierarchy, but one thing you can not do is create a new menu. In order for you to get your menus to reappear in case you accidentally deleted one, you need to delete your user configuration file from the installation folder and relaunch Multisim or Ultiboard. A new configuration file will be generated when the program is restarted. Note: You will lose any customizations to the user interface. Version 10.x The file you are looking for will be in this folder:
The file is typically called: standard_ms_uni.ewcfg or standard_ub_uni.ewcfg, but you can always check the exact name in Options » Global Preferences » Paths tab. Delete this file and relaunch Multisim or Ultiboard. Your User Interface should now be the original. Version 9 (and older versions) The file you are looking for will be in any of these folders, depending on the product you are using and the installation directory:
The file you are looking for is called: <username>.ewcfg. Delete this file and relaunch Multisim or Ultiboard. Your User Interface will returne to its default layout.
